The Karl Storz UF-902 footpedal is an essential accessory for those using the AUTOCON 400 system for endoscopic procedures. This footpedal, manufactured by the renowned Karl Storz brand, is designed to provide optimal control and comfort during surgical procedures.
The UF-902 footpedal boasts a sleek, modern design that seamlessly integrates with the AUTOCON 400 system. It features a large, non-slip foot plate that ensures a stable and secure foot position during the procedure. The footpedal is adjustable, allowing users to customize the position to their preference for maximum comfort and convenience.
The pedal has two independent foot switches, each with adjustable resistance. This feature enables the user to set the resistance level for each switch according to their needs, providing greater control over the endoscope. The switches are designed to be quiet and responsive, minimizing any distractions during the procedure.
The UF-902 footpedal is built with high-quality materials that ensure durability and longevity. It is made of robust, corrosion-resistant materials that can withstand the rigors of frequent use in a medical setting. The pedal also features a waterproof design, making it suitable for use in wet environments.
This footpedal is easy to install and connect to the AUTOCON 400 system. It comes with a secure, snap-on connection that ensures a stable and reliable connection between the footpedal and the system. The footpedal is also compatible with other Karl Storz endoscopic systems, making it a versatile and valuable addition to any endoscopy suite.
